#423049 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#423049 is composed of 25.9% red, 18.8% green and 28.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 9.6% cyan, 34.2% magenta, 0% yellow and 71.4% black. It has a hue angle of 283.2 degrees, a saturation of 20.7% and a lightness of 23.7%. #423049 color hex could be obtained by blending #846092 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#333333.

Shades and Tints of #423049

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020102 is the darkest color, while #f8f5f9 is the lightest one.

Tones of #423049

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#3e3940 is the less saturated color, while #560178 is the most saturated one.
